VMware安装Centos7(图文)

本篇文章主要介绍了VMware安装Centos7超详细过程(图文),具有一定的参考价值,感兴趣的小伙伴们可以参考一下

1.软硬件准备

软件:推荐使用VMwear,我用的是VMwear 15 Pro
下载地址:http://mirrors.aliyun.com/centos/7.8.2003/isos/x86_64/CentOS-7-x86_64-DVD-2003.iso

2.虚拟机准备

1.打开VMwear选择新建虚拟机
在这里插入图片描述
2.典型安装与自定义安装

典型安装:VMwear会将主流的配置应用在虚拟机的操作系统上,对于新手来很友好。

自定义安装:自定义安装可以针对性的把一些资源加强,把不需要的资源移除。避免资源的浪费。

这里我选择典型安装。
在这里插入图片描述
3.选择稍后安装操作系统
在这里插入图片描述
4.操作系统的选择

这里选择之后安装的操作系统,正确的选择会让vm tools更好的兼容。这里选择linux下的CentOS
在这里插入图片描述
5.虚拟机位置与命名

虚拟机名称就是一个名字,在虚拟机多的时候方便自己找到。

VMwear的默认位置是在C盘下,我这里改成D盘。
在这里插入图片描述
6.磁盘容量
如果你不经常使用那就默认就好
在这里插入图片描述
7.点击完成就好
在这里插入图片描述

8.编辑虚拟机设置
在这里插入图片描述
这些基本上默认就好,主要是你需要将你下载的iso镜像导入进去,还有就是如果你经常使用就可以多给几个核且内存给大一点就好了,这里其实我将打印机硬件都移除了,因为根本用不着
在这里插入图片描述
选择你下载好的镜像,配置完成
在这里插入图片描述

8.网络连接类型的选择,网络连接类型一共有桥接、NAT、仅主机和不联网四种。

桥接:选择桥接模式的话虚拟机和宿主机在网络上就是平级的关系,相当于连接在同一交换机上,桥接就相当于一台真实主机,能直接和外界相互通信

NAT:NAT模式就是虚拟机要联网得先通过宿主机才能和外面进行通信,所以外界直接访问NAT模式下的虚拟机时访问不到的

仅主机:虚拟机与宿主机直接连起来,只能与本机通信

桥接与NAT模式访问互联网过程,如下图所示
在这里插入图片描述

3.安装CentOS

开启虚拟机后会出现以下界面

Install CentOS 7 安装CentOS 7
Test this media & install CentOS 7 测试安装文件并安装CentOS 7
Troubleshooting 修复故障
选择第一项,安装直接CentOS 7,回车,进入下面的界面
在这里插入图片描述
选择安装过程中使用的语言,这里选择英文、键盘选择美式键盘。点击Continue
在这里插入图片描述首先设置时间
在这里插入图片描述
时区选择上海,查看时间是否正确。然后点击Done
在这里插入图片描述
选择需要安装的软件
在这里插入图片描述
选择 Server with Gui,然后点击Done
在这里插入图片描述
选择安装位置,在这里可以进行磁盘划分,这里懒得分,可以选择自动分配
在这里插入图片描述
如下图所示,点击加号,选择/boot,给boot分区分200M。最后点击Add
在这里插入图片描述
然后以同样的办法给其他三个区分配好空间后点击Done
在这里插入图片描述
然后会弹出摘要信息,点击AcceptChanges(接受更改)
在这里插入图片描述
设置主机名与网卡信息
在这里插入图片描述
首先要打开网卡,然后查看是否能获取到IP地址(我这里是桥接),再更改主机名后点击Done。
在这里插入图片描述
最后选择Begin Installation(开始安装)
在这里插入图片描述
设置root密码
在这里插入图片描述
设置root密码后点击Done
在这里插入图片描述
点击USER CREATION 创建管理员用户
在这里插入图片描述
输入用户名密码后点击Done
在这里插入图片描述
等待系统安装完毕重启系统即可
在这里插入图片描述
桥接模式网络配置

1、配置ip地址等信息在/etc/sysconfig/network-scripts/ifcfg-ens33文件里做如下配置:

命令:

vi   /etc/sysconfig/network-scripts/ifcfg-ens33

修改如下:

TYPE="Ethernet"   # 网络类型为以太网
BOOTPROTO="static"  # 手动分配ip
NAME="ens33"  # 网卡设备名,设备名一定要跟文件名一致
DEVICE="ens33"  # 网卡设备名,设备名一定要跟文件名一致
ONBOOT="yes"  # 该网卡是否随网络服务启动
IPADDR="192.168.220.101"  # 该网卡ip地址就是你要配置的固定IP,如果你要用xshell等工具连接,220这个网段最好和你自己的电脑网段一致,否则有可能用xshell连接失败
GATEWAY="192.168.220.2"   # 网关
NETMASK="255.255.255.0"   # 子网掩码
DNS1="8.8.8.8"    # DNS,8.8.8.8为Google提供的免费DNS服务器的IP地址

2、配置网络工作

在/etc/sysconfig/network文件里增加如下配置

命令:
 
vi /etc/sysconfig/network
 
修改:
 
NETWORKING=yes # 网络是否工作,此处一定不能为no

3、配置公共DNS服务(可选)

在/etc/resolv.conf文件里增加如下配置

nameserver 8.8.8.8

4、关闭防火墙

systemctl stop firewalld # 临时关闭防火墙
systemctl disable firewalld # 禁止开机启动

5、重启网络服务

service network restart

下面是克隆虚拟机:

先查看虚拟机的网关
在这里插入图片描述
2、将要克隆的虚拟机关机,右键点击要克隆的虚拟机:

右键点击虚拟机,选择“管理”、“克隆”
在这里插入图片描述
下一步
在这里插入图片描述
下一步
在这里插入图片描述
选择第二个“创建完整克隆”,后下一步
在这里插入图片描述
给自己的克隆机命名、选择位置后点击“完成”。
在这里插入图片描述
然后就开始克隆了,时间不会太久,整个过程大概1~2分钟。

完成克隆后点击关闭即克隆成功了。此时是可以在虚拟机列表中看到刚刚克隆的虚拟机“Clone”的。如下:
在这里插入图片描述
修改配置文件/etc/sysconfig/network-scripts/ifcfg-ens33中的IPADDR

IPADDR="192.168.220.102"

修改主机名:

hostnamectl set-hostname   xxxx(你要的主机名字)

修改hosts文件,将名字和IP建立联系

输入命令“vi /etc/hosts”后,在配置文件中加入

127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4
::1         localhost localhost.localdomain localhost6 localhost6.localdomain6
192.168.220.103(你锁修改的主机IP)   xxxxxxxx(你要的主机名字)

重启:reboot

这里还介绍我这里遇到的几个问题
1、输入法问题
如果安装的是中文版Centos,这里可能要自己装

  • 输入法的安装
    采用 yum install ibus-libpinyin命令安装,如果出现“Package ibus-libpinyin-1.6.91-4.el7.x86_64 already installed and latest version”,则说明输入法已经安装。只需要进行启用操作

  • Centos 7 启用中文输入法
    Applications ->System Tools ->Setting ->Regin & Language,出现如下图所示的对话框,点击对话框中的“+”添加Chinese输入法。
    在这里插入图片描述
    安装完成后会看到桌面右上角初有个语言的选项,如下图所示,可以点击选择相应的输入法,也可以按shift来进行输入法的切换
    在这里插入图片描述

2.切换root用户报错问题
你可以在执行sudo -su时出现 用户不在 sudoers 文件中。此事将被报告。
普通linux用户使用sudo命令执行只有root用户才可以执行的命令时出现了该错误,如下图示:
在这里插入图片描述
简单说明一下操作。命令$ ll /etc/sudoers表示查看文件的属性,属性包括有:文件拥有者、文件所属组以及其他用户组对该文件拥有的读写权限和文件的类型等,上图的/etc/sudoers文件表示拥有者和所属组都是root且只能读取,其他用户组的没有任何读写权限。

命令$ sudo cat /etc/sudoers表示当前登录用户是普通用户hpx,我想使用该用户查看/etc/sudoers文件的内容,由于需要有root权限才能查看该文件的内容,于是使用sudo命令来让普通用户临时拥有root权限来执行查看内容命令,但是后面输入密码后发现命令无法成功执行(查看失败了),报错标题所诉hpx不在 sudoers 文件中。此事将被报错

解决方案

根据错误提示,只需将当前登录用户,图中所示用户是zouqi加入到sudoers文件中即可。

  • 切换至root用户
$ su - root

在这里插入图片描述

  • 给root用户添加可写权限
chmod 640 /etc/sudoers

在这里插入图片描述

  • 修改sudoers文件
vim /etc/sudoers

在这里插入图片描述
如上图所示位置加上hpx ALL=(ALL) ALL后,按下esc键,输入:wq保存修改并退出编辑。

普通用户继续使用sudo命令验证

exit

然后尝试使用sudo su登录,发现已经成功登录
在这里插入图片描述
参考链接:
https://blog.csdn.net/qq_38880380/article/details/79013365
https://blog.csdn.net/csdnzouqi/article/details/95499348

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值